Chapter 83
"You really need to be more careful." Xavier carefully tended to Natasha's wound.
Their faces were so close that it made Natasha pause. She couldn't help but ask, "You say you're not looking for a girlfriend, and you just follow me around conducting research every day. If you end up single forever, will you blame me?"
"Don't worry. If I end up with no one to care for me, I'll just cling to you and never leave." Xavier joked as he carried the topic further.
Natasha, on the other hand, was genuinely thinking of finding him a girlfriend.
"So? What's your type? You can't just stay glued to me forever," she remarked while eating.
"Give me a break. You're not even fully recovered yet, and you're already trying to play matchmaker?" he responded.
Xavier had always kept someone in his heart. However, he knew the two of them getting together would never be possible in this lifetime. Thus, he'd rather grow old alone than spend a lifetime with someone he didn't truly love.
"Instead of worrying about me, maybe you should worry about yourself," he said sharply.
To him, Natasha was the one buried in the research facility all day, practically cut off from the rest of the world. He only said that because he cared as a friend.
Suddenly, Natasha sat up straight and asked, "What do you think of Zachary?"
Talking about Zachary made Natasha feel the distance between them. After all, he was a man with assets in the hundreds of millions.
"Anyone but Zachary," Xavier replied firmly.
He had seen it clearly. Every time Zachary was around, Natasha ended up getting hurt.
"I don't think he's that bad," Natasha murmured.
Even at his worst, Zachary was still far better than Matthew ever was. Natasha knew what it felt like to be pathetic in love.

At the time, Natasha was working part-time to support herself. However, because she kept dropping everything for Matthew, she was eventually fired.
"You can read a face but not a heart. Just be careful," Xavier reminded her.
After all, his opinion of Zachary was mostly built on rumors. He understood that judging someone too quickly wasn't ideal, but it often gave him a surprisingly accurate read on people.
Natasha ended up staying for two more days. Once the doctor confirmed everything was fine, they finally prepared to leave.
"Mr. Anderson, are you coming back with us?" Natasha asked.
With her backpack slung over her shoulder, Natasha stood at the dock. She watched the ship slowly approach from a distance. It was definitely bigger and more luxurious than the last one.
"Ms. Bradley, Mr. Foster. Sorry to keep you waiting," Quentin said.
Unlike how he looked during the seminar, today he showed up in casual clothes, which caught Natasha off guard in a good way.
"The main reason I'm heading back to Cendale is to ensure that the collaborative research project with Mr. Foster can move forward smoothly," he added.
Quentin's words brought Natasha back to reality. Everything she had now, she owed to Zachary. Regardless of his intentions, it all meant a great deal to her.
Xavier clenched his teeth, cursing the two of them under his breath for being so underhanded. If Julian hadn't secretly followed him and dug up some information, they probably still wouldn't know what Natasha truly wanted.
The two continued their conversation as they waited for the ship to dock.
